Resource Summary: Studies show that in an integrated, team-based environment, just one burned-out staff member can disrupt team dynamics. But even in times of high stress, health center staff are more likely to be engaged and satisfied with their jobs if given the tools they need to succeed, in an organization that fosters resiliency.

Resource Details: Join the Association of Clinicians for the Underserved’s (ACU) STAR² Center for this hour-long webinar designed to highlight the role of health center leadership in fostering an organizational culture of resilience and workforce well-being, and providing concrete tips to spur this culture change, combat stress, and reduce burnout among their staff—ultimately building stronger teams.
